I want to restrict a user Sate wise in SAP. Suppose a user working for ABC state - Below restriction need to be maintain -:
1 . He/She cannot create sales order of other state other than ABC State.
2. Even he cannot see other state customer from F4 ( search option ) .
3. Can we add State in Organization level for control user to access customer data of other state.
4. How we can maintain authorization object for state in SAP.

Can't the "state" be configured as part of the sales area (e.g. Division)? Then you'd be able to use standard authorizations.
Otherwise you're talking loads of custom development.

1) At Sales Order level you want to restrict the State at Customer Level or Plant level.
EX : Customer and Plant belong to same state .
2) To restrict F4 search discuss with your ABAP' er to include a Customized search option but you need to finalize it whether Customer State or Delivery Plant state.
